Does exist any specific prescription in the scriptures, any directive from our acaryas, any instruction from Srila Prabhupada or at least any GBC resolution about that a Vaisnava cannot chant the Holy Names in another temple or vaishnava line outside his own? 


I ask this because I have always seen, and have participated in many Kirtan events in various Yoga centers and all kinds of spaces, freely as Srila Prabhupada wished, trying to bring the holy name to more people.


But it happens that when I have been invited to chant HK in spaces of other Vaisnava lines, that has generated a "disturbance" in the minds of few people in the local temple.

Then they try to generate an idea in the community that it is "forbidden" to chant the holy name in other Vaisnava spaces.


🤷🏻‍♂️

Please let me know if there is any philosophical, sastrical or at least administrative basis that supports this type of thinking.
